DSLR times of minima of selected eclipsing binaries

Abstract
We present a collection of eclipse timings of eclipsing binary stars obtained over the extended time interval 2014-2024. In all observations, a DSLR camera was used as the detector. The presented dataset contains 250 previously unpublished minima of 86 eclipsing binary systems obtained at three observing sites. The minima were determined from calibrated light curves using the phenomenological modelling approach, and their uncertainties were estimated by bootstrap resampling. The presented measurements extend the available timing coverage of the observed systems and may contribute to future studies of orbital period variations and other long-term phenomena in eclipsing binaries.
